The Advantages Of Additive Manufacturing Powder Bed Fusion

Additive manufacturing, also known as 3D printing, has revolutionized the way products are designed and manufactured. Among the various types of additive manufacturing technologies, powder bed fusion is a popular choice for producing complex and high-quality parts. This article will explore the advantages of additive manufacturing powder bed fusion and how it is shaping the future of manufacturing.

At its core, powder bed fusion is a process that uses a laser or electron beam to selectively melt and solidify layers of powdered material to build up a three-dimensional object. This layer-by-layer approach allows for the creation of intricate and precise geometries that would be difficult or impossible to achieve using traditional manufacturing methods. This makes powder bed fusion ideal for producing complex parts with intricate details and fine features.

One of the key advantages of powder bed fusion is its ability to produce parts with high accuracy and dimensional stability. The layer-by-layer process ensures that the final parts have tight tolerances and consistent geometry, leading to parts that meet or exceed the design specifications. This level of precision is essential for industries such as aerospace, medical, and automotive, where parts must meet strict performance requirements.

Another advantage of powder bed fusion is its ability to produce parts with excellent mechanical properties. The selective melting of the powder results in parts with uniform material properties, such as density and strength, across the entire part. This is in contrast to traditional manufacturing methods, where parts may have varying properties due to machining or other processes. As a result, parts produced using powder bed fusion are often stronger and more durable, making them suitable for demanding applications.

In addition to accuracy and mechanical properties, powder bed fusion offers design flexibility that is unmatched by traditional manufacturing methods. Since parts are built layer by layer, designers have the freedom to create complex geometries and internal structures that would be impossible to manufacture using other techniques. This allows for the optimization of part performance and functionality, leading to enhanced product design and innovation.

Powder bed fusion is also a cost-effective manufacturing method for producing low to medium volume parts. The ability to produce parts on demand and without the need for expensive tooling or setup costs can result in significant savings compared to traditional manufacturing methods. This is particularly beneficial for industries that require frequent design changes or customization, as powder bed fusion allows for rapid prototyping and production of new parts.

Furthermore, powder bed fusion is a sustainable manufacturing method that can reduce material waste and energy consumption. Since only the required amount of powder is used for each part, there is minimal material waste compared to subtractive manufacturing methods, where excess material is often discarded. Additionally, the layer-by-layer approach of powder bed fusion consumes less energy compared to traditional manufacturing methods, making it a more environmentally friendly option.

The Benefits Of Using A Reach And Wash System For Window Cleaning

Window cleaning is an essential part of building maintenance. Clean windows not only improve the overall appearance of a building but also allow more light to enter the space. While traditional methods of window cleaning involve ladders, squeegees, and detergents, the reach and wash system offers a modern and more efficient approach to this task.

The reach and wash system is a method of window cleaning that utilizes telescopic poles and purified water to clean windows from the ground. This system is becoming increasingly popular among professional window cleaners due to its many benefits. In this article, we will explore the advantages of using a reach and wash system for window cleaning.

One of the main benefits of the reach and wash system is its safety features. Traditional window cleaning methods involving ladders can be hazardous, especially when working at heights. The reach and wash system eliminates the need for ladders, as window cleaners can clean windows from the ground using telescopic poles. This reduces the risk of accidents and injuries, making it a safer option for both the cleaners and the occupants of the building.

Another advantage of the reach and wash system is its efficiency. The telescopic poles used in this system allow window cleaners to reach windows that are difficult to access with traditional methods. This means that even high-rise buildings can be cleaned quickly and effectively using the reach and wash system. Additionally, the purified water used in this system helps to remove dirt and grime from windows more easily, resulting in a streak-free finish.

The reach and wash system is also environmentally friendly. Unlike traditional window cleaning methods that rely on detergents and chemicals, the reach and wash system only uses purified water to clean windows. This means that no harmful chemicals are released into the environment, making it a more sustainable and eco-friendly option. Additionally, the purified water used in this system is free from impurities that can leave residue on windows, resulting in a cleaner and more hygienic finish.

Cost-effectiveness is another benefit of using the reach and wash system for window cleaning. While the initial investment in telescopic poles and a water purification system may be higher than traditional window cleaning equipment, the long-term savings make it a more cost-effective option. The reach and wash system allows window cleaners to work more quickly and efficiently, reducing labor costs. Additionally, the purified water used in this system helps to prevent streaking, reducing the need for re-cleaning and saving both time and money.

One of the key advantages of the reach and wash system is its versatility. This system can be used to clean a wide range of surfaces, including windows, cladding, solar panels, and signage. The telescopic poles used in this system can be adjusted to different lengths, allowing window cleaners to reach even the most awkwardly positioned windows. This versatility makes the reach and wash system a valuable tool for professional window cleaners who need to clean a variety of surfaces.

The Impact Of Biotechnology And Biopharmaceuticals In Revolutionizing Medicine

biotechnology and biopharmaceuticals have had a profound impact on the field of medicine, revolutionizing the way we approach the treatment of diseases and disorders. These two branches of science have paved the way for innovative therapies and advancements in healthcare that were once thought to be impossible. In this article, we will explore the rise of biotechnology and biopharmaceuticals, their significance in the medical field, and their contribution to improving human health and well-being.

Biotechnology refers to the use of living organisms or biological systems to develop products or processes that benefit society. This field encompasses a wide range of disciplines, including genetics, molecular biology, biochemistry, and microbiology. Biotechnology plays a crucial role in the development of new drugs, vaccines, and diagnostics, as well as in the production of biofuels, agricultural products, and industrial enzymes. Biopharmaceuticals, on the other hand, are a subset of biotechnology that focuses specifically on the development of pharmaceutical drugs derived from biological sources, such as living cells or proteins.

The advent of biotechnology and biopharmaceuticals has revolutionized the field of medicine by providing new avenues for treating diseases that were once considered incurable. One of the most significant contributions of biotechnology to medicine is the development of recombinant DNA technology, which allows scientists to manipulate and modify the genetic material of living organisms to produce specific proteins or enzymes. This technology has led to the creation of a wide range of biopharmaceutical products, such as insulin for diabetes, growth hormones for growth disorders, and clotting factors for hemophilia.

biotechnology and biopharmaceuticals have also played a crucial role in the development of personalized medicine, a healthcare approach that tailors medical treatments to individual patients based on their genetic makeup. By analyzing a patient’s genetic profile, doctors can identify the most effective drug therapies for that individual, minimizing the risk of adverse reactions and maximizing treatment outcomes. Personalized medicine has the potential to revolutionize the way we treat diseases, offering patients more targeted and efficient treatments that are tailored to their specific needs.

Another significant contribution of biotechnology and biopharmaceuticals to medicine is the development of monoclonal antibodies, a class of drugs that target specific proteins or cells in the body to treat a variety of diseases, including cancer, autoimmune disorders, and infectious diseases. Monoclonal antibodies have proven to be highly effective in treating a wide range of medical conditions, offering patients a less invasive and more targeted treatment option compared to traditional chemotherapy or surgery. These drugs are designed to selectively bind to disease-causing molecules while sparing healthy cells, minimizing side effects and improving patient outcomes.

biotechnology and biopharmaceuticals have also revolutionized the field of regenerative medicine, a branch of medicine that aims to restore or replace damaged tissues and organs in the body. Stem cell therapy, a type of regenerative medicine that uses stem cells to repair damaged tissues, has shown promising results in treating a variety of conditions, including spinal cord injuries, heart disease, and diabetes. By harnessing the regenerative potential of stem cells, scientists are exploring new ways to regenerate damaged tissues and organs, offering hope to patients who are in need of life-saving treatments.

The Versatility And Strength Of Stainless Steel Self Tapping Screws

When it comes to fastening materials together, having the right screws for the job is crucial. One type of screw that is commonly used for various applications is the stainless steel self tapping screw. These screws are specially designed to create their own threads as they are driven into the material, making them ideal for securing materials that may not have pre-drilled holes. In this article, we will explore the benefits and uses of stainless steel self tapping screws.

stainless steel self tapping screws are known for their strength and durability. Made from high-quality stainless steel, these screws are resistant to corrosion and rust, making them perfect for outdoor applications or projects that are exposed to moisture. This strength also makes them suitable for heavy-duty tasks that require a secure and long-lasting connection.

One of the key advantages of stainless steel self tapping screws is their ability to create their own threads. This eliminates the need for tapping or drilling holes before inserting the screws, saving time and effort. This feature also makes these screws highly versatile, as they can be used on a wide range of materials such as metal, wood, plastic, and composite materials.

Another benefit of stainless steel self tapping screws is their ease of installation. With a sharp, pointed tip and a wide, flat head, these screws can be driven into materials with minimal effort. This makes them ideal for DIY enthusiasts or professional builders who need a fast and efficient way to secure materials together.

stainless steel self tapping screws come in a variety of sizes and styles to suit different applications. From pan head screws for general purpose fastening to hex washer head screws for more heavy-duty tasks, there is a self tapping screw available for every project. The choice of screw head style can also impact the appearance of the finished project, making it easy to achieve the desired aesthetic.

In addition to their strength and versatility, stainless steel self tapping screws are also known for their long-lasting performance. The stainless steel material is highly resistant to wear and tear, ensuring that the screws will remain secure and in place for years to come. This makes them a cost-effective and reliable choice for projects that require a durable fastening solution.

One common use for stainless steel self tapping screws is in the construction industry. Whether it is for building new structures, installing roofing panels, or securing metal siding, these screws are essential for creating strong and stable connections. The corrosion-resistant properties of stainless steel make them particularly well-suited for outdoor projects that are exposed to the elements.

stainless steel self tapping screws are also commonly used in woodworking projects. Whether it is for assembling furniture, cabinets, or decking, these screws provide a secure and reliable fastening solution that is easy to install. The self tapping feature of these screws eliminates the need for pre-drilling holes in wood, saving time and effort during the construction process.

In the automotive industry, stainless steel self tapping screws are used for securing various components together. From interior trim panels to engine covers, these screws provide a strong and durable connection that can withstand the vibrations and stresses of daily driving. The corrosion-resistant properties of stainless steel also make these screws ideal for use in under-the-hood applications where exposure to moisture and chemicals is a concern.

Understanding The Ins And Outs Of Eviction Legal Process

Dealing with a potential eviction is a stressful and daunting experience for both landlords and tenants. Understanding the legal process surrounding eviction is crucial to ensure that the rights of both parties are protected. The eviction legal process can vary depending on the state and local laws, but there are some general steps that are typically involved. In this article, we will explore the key aspects of eviction legal process.

The first step in the eviction legal process is usually the issuance of a notice to the tenant. This notice informs the tenant that they are in violation of the lease agreement and gives them a certain amount of time to either remedy the situation or vacate the premises. The specific requirements for this notice can vary depending on the state laws, but it is typically required to be in writing and delivered to the tenant in person or posted on the property.

If the tenant fails to comply with the notice, the landlord can then file a formal eviction lawsuit with the court. The landlord will need to follow the specific procedures set forth by state law for filing the lawsuit and serving the tenant with the necessary court documents. The tenant will have the opportunity to respond to the lawsuit and present their side of the case in court.

Once the eviction lawsuit is filed, the court will schedule a hearing where both parties will have the opportunity to present evidence and arguments. The judge will then make a decision based on the evidence presented and the applicable laws. If the judge rules in favor of the landlord, they will issue a court order for the tenant to vacate the premises.

If the tenant still refuses to vacate after the court order is issued, the landlord may need to involve law enforcement to physically remove the tenant from the property. This process can vary depending on the jurisdiction, but it is typically carried out by the local sheriff or constable.

It is important for both landlords and tenants to be aware of their rights and responsibilities throughout the eviction legal process. Landlords must follow all applicable laws and procedures to ensure that the eviction is conducted legally and ethically. Tenants have the right to defend themselves in court and present evidence to support their case.

In some cases, tenants may have grounds to challenge the eviction on legal grounds. This could include improper notice, discrimination, or retaliatory eviction. It is important for tenants to seek legal counsel if they believe their rights are being violated during the eviction process.
